About the Author

Jayne Flaagan has lived in both North Dakota and Minnesota her entire life. She currently resides in East Grand Forks with her husband and a Husky dog named Ella. She also has three adult children. Flaagan has degrees in Advertising/Public Relations, Elementary Education and French. She has over 30 years of experience in Early Childhood education and has extensive expertise in writing for many different publications and in several different genres. The author can speak Spanish, loves to travel, read, do crossword puzzles, and spend time with her family, as well as having various other hobbies and past times.

Praise for "Doggy Loves Christmas" "Simply Charming" "Doggy Celebrates Christmas" is the latest in a series of books by Jayne Flaagan which chronicles the adventures of Ella the dog throughout life's milestones. I have enjoyed reading many of her other books and this book is no exception. Flaagan has succeeded once again in integrating the teaching of developmental vocabulary, comprehension skills, math shapes, and an introduction to cultural traditions for preschoolers into a rich photographic essay. In the story, Ella's family is preparing for Christmas by setting up the Christmas tree, crèche, and baking cookies. Flaagan incorporates cognitive thinking skills on many pages, while enabling parents or teachers to foster a dialogue with youngsters about their own family traditions. I highly recommend this book for parents to introduce young children to holiday traditions. The Ella the Doggy book series is a wonderful addition to any home library! Vava C. Schroeder, M. Ed. Director of Education Sylvan Learning Center
